Is the 1997 VAUXHALL ASTRAVAN reliable?

Good reliability. Occasional issues but generally solid. That's 6 points above the national average of 82%. It also outperforms the VAUXHALL brand average of 84%.

At 27 years old, 88% of VAUXHALL ASTRAVANs from 1997 passed their MOT first time in 2024. That's based on 32 tests across the UK. The average mileage at this age is 115,759 miles.

Mileage Analysis

The average 1997 VAUXHALL ASTRAVAN has 115,759 miles on the clock, which is below the expected 199,800 miles for a 27-year-old car. This suggests lighter use than average, which generally means less wear on major components.
